WebOvereating disorder is a condition characterized by compulsive overeating but without the purging behaviors seen in bulimia nervosa. People with this disorder frequently eat large amounts of food in a short period of time and feel unable to control their eating. WebNov 23, 2011 · "I ate so much I'm about to burst!" ... WebMay 27, 2015 · Researchers have found that by doing this at least once a week for 4 weeks, 70% of the children in the study were better able to self-regulate their eating. Kids who are allowed to feel hungry can better distinguish between what it physically feels like to feel hungry and emotional hunger like boredom. The idea of moderation is an inherent part of Islam. WebOvereating is in many cases due to overeating fat because it's the biggest macro in calories. While eating 1g of carbs or protein equals 4 calories, 1g of fat is 9 calories. That's more than twice as much. Which makes it a lot easier for you …

These include type 2 diabetes, heart and blood vessel... birthday gifts for her westernWebApr 19, 2024 · A major part of that relationship is the link between sleep and overeating. Sleep deprivation can affect appetite and food choices, increasing the likelihood of both overeating and consuming unhealthy foods. Overeating can affect sleep as well.
